Julio Baptista wants to remain at Roma despite reports linking him with a move to England.
The former Arsenal forward is a reported target of Manchester City.
"I am not thinking about leaving Roma," said Baptista, who is with Brazil at the Confederations Cup in South Africa.
"I signed a four-year contract with Roma and I want to remain and help the team do better with respect to last season.
"Our aim will be to return to the Champions League."
The 27-year-old joined the Eternal City outfit last summer from Real Madrid.
Baptista scored nine times in 27 Serie A appearances to help Roma finish sixth in the league standings.
